* As per my surgical experience, the inability of urination with pain indicates acute retention of urine in the bladder.
There can be underlying prostate enlargement, calculus in the urinary system or other issues.
* My recommendations at present
- Immediately consult at ER and get urine through catheter after examination by a surgeon.
- Pain relief with analgesic tablet as aleve or tylenol till you reach the ER.
- Discuss the need of diagnostic ultrasound examination of abdomen, pelvis with prostate size for further management guidelines with your doctor.
